Wedding Videographer Consultation Tips: What to Ask First
Start your conversation with the basics. These questions set the foundation for everything else:
How would you describe your videography style?
Every videographer has a unique style - cinematic, documentary, storytelling, or a mix. Knowing their style helps you decide if it matches your vision.
Do you have experience filming Punjabi or South Asian weddings?
These weddings are rich in traditions and vibrant moments. A videographer familiar with the customs will know when and where to capture the best shots.
Can I see a full wedding video from start to finish?
Highlight reels are beautiful but don’t tell the whole story. Watching a full video shows you how they handle the entire event.
What packages do you offer, and what’s included?
Ask about hours of coverage, number of videographers, drone footage, and extras like highlight reels or raw footage.
How do you handle audio, especially during ceremonies and speeches?
Clear audio is crucial for capturing vows and heartfelt moments. Find out if they use lapel mics or other professional equipment.
These questions help you get a clear picture of what to expect and how well the videographer fits your needs.
Diving Deeper: Wedding Videographer Consultation Tips for Details
Once you’ve covered the basics, it’s time to dig into the details that make a difference on your wedding day:
What is your backup plan if equipment fails or you are unavailable?
Reliability is key. A professional videographer will have backup gear and a contingency plan.
How do you coordinate with photographers and other vendors?
Smooth collaboration ensures no moments are missed or interrupted.
Can you accommodate specific cultural or religious rituals?
Make sure they understand the significance of your traditions and know how to film them respectfully.
What is your editing process and timeline?
Knowing when you’ll receive your video helps you plan your post-wedding excitement.
Do you provide raw footage or just the edited video?
Some couples want access to all the footage to relive every moment.
Are there any travel fees or additional costs I should know about?
Transparency about pricing avoids surprises later.
These questions show your attention to detail and help you find a videographer who is professional, prepared, and respectful of your unique wedding.

Understanding the Experience and Personality Fit
Your wedding videographer will be with you throughout your big day. It’s important to feel comfortable and confident in their presence. Here are some tips to gauge their personality and experience:
Ask about their previous weddings in Brampton and the GTA.
Local experience means they know the venues, lighting conditions, and cultural nuances.
How do you handle unexpected changes or delays during the wedding?
Flexibility and calmness under pressure are essential traits.
Can you share testimonials or references from past clients?
Hearing from other couples, especially those with similar cultural backgrounds, builds trust.
What do you enjoy most about filming weddings?
Their passion will shine through in their work and attitude.
How do you ensure you capture candid moments without being intrusive?
The best videographers blend into the background while still capturing every smile and tear.
Finding a videographer who is not only skilled but also warm and approachable makes your wedding day experience even more special.
Finalizing Your Choice: Practical Tips for a Smooth Wedding Video Experience
Before you sign the contract, make sure you cover these final points:
Confirm the delivery format and how you will receive your video.
Digital download, USB drive, or DVD? Choose what works best for you.
Discuss music choices and any restrictions.
Some videographers use licensed music or allow you to pick songs.
Ask about rights and usage of your wedding video.
Will you be able to share it on social media or with family?
Clarify payment terms and cancellation policies.
Understanding the financial details protects you both.
Schedule a follow-up meeting or call before the wedding.
This ensures everyone is on the same page and ready for the big day.
Taking these steps guarantees a smooth, stress-free experience and a stunning wedding video you’ll treasure forever.
